Identifying Key Retro Trainer Styles
Several retro trainer styles have solidified their place in fashion history. Understanding their defining characteristics is key to choosing the perfect pair for your personal style.
-
Adidas Superstars: These iconic shell-toe sneakers, launched in 1969, are instantly recognizable. Their clean design and versatile styling make them a wardrobe staple. Consider the various colorways available, from classic white to bold and vibrant options. Styling tips include pairing them with jeans, tailored pants or even a dress for a contrasting effect.
-
Nike Air Force 1s: Originally designed for basketball, the Air Force 1s have become a cultural icon. Their diverse variations, from low-tops to high-tops and countless colorways, offer endless possibilities. Explore different materials, including leather and suede, to find your perfect fit. Styling these can be as simple as pairing them with jeans and a tee, or dressing them up with a skirt and blazer.
-
Converse Chuck Taylors: A classic canvas sneaker, the Chuck Taylors represent timeless simplicity. They're available in high-top and low-top versions, offering versatility for any occasion. Explore different colors and patterns to personalize your style. These can be styled with everything from dresses and skirts to jeans and shorts, proving their remarkable versatility.
-
Puma Suedes: The Puma Suede, known for its suede upper and sleek silhouette, offers a more understated yet equally iconic retro option. Originally a sportswear shoe, its simple lines and versatility made it a streetwear and fashion staple, easily dressed up or down.
Styling Your Retro Trainers: From Casual to Chic
The beauty of retro trainers lies in their versatility. They can be styled for a variety of occasions, seamlessly transitioning from casual daywear to more polished ensembles.
-
Casual looks: Pair your retro trainers with your favorite jeans and a t-shirt for an effortless everyday look. Alternatively, a flowing dress paired with retro sneakers creates a surprisingly chic and modern contrast.
-
Smart casual looks: Chinos, tailored skirts, or even tailored jackets paired with retro trainers create a sophisticated smart-casual vibe. This balance of dressed-up and down is particularly stylish.
-
More adventurous outfits: Don't be afraid to experiment! Mixing high and low, such as a vintage tee with a designer skirt and retro trainers, can create a uniquely stylish look. Bold colors and patterns add personality to your outfit.
-
Accessories to complement retro trainer outfits: The right accessories can elevate any outfit. Consider colorful socks, a stylish tote bag, or delicate jewelry to enhance your retro trainer look.
Where to Find Authentic Retro Trainers
Finding authentic retro trainers is essential to ensure quality and style. Here are some reliable sources:
-
Reputable online retailers: Sites such as ASOS, END. Clothing, and StockX offer a wide selection of authentic retro trainers. Always check seller ratings and reviews.
-
Vintage stores and secondhand markets: Explore local vintage stores and online marketplaces like eBay and Depop for unique finds and potential bargains. Be sure to check the condition carefully before purchasing.
-
Official brand websites: Purchasing directly from Adidas, Nike, Converse, or Puma ensures authenticity. You may find limited edition or classic designs unavailable elsewhere.
-
Tips for spotting fake retro trainers: Carefully examine stitching, logos, and materials. Authentic retro trainers will have a superior quality feel and construction.
